Sir Hugh John Macdonald Walking Tour

In-Person

Take a walk with Sir Hugh John Macdonald from his home at Dalnavert to the Millennium Library. En route, Sir Hugh will introduce you to the many downtown sites that touched his life and continue to play a role in Winnipeg's urban setting. At the Millennium Library, the tour will wrap up in the Local History Room where participants will learn how to find out more about the people, places, and history that surrounds us every day. Tour will proceed in rain or shine.
